A recent study reported in the Journal of the American Medical Association (JAMA) revealed that the use of medication for the treatment of OUD increased among Medicaid enrollees from 2014 to 2018. In the 11 States included in this study, MAT for OUD increased from 47.8% in 2014 to 57.1% in 2018. Researchers noted Medicaid expansion accounted for some of these increases and, while this study did reveal an improvement in access to medications for OUD treatment, researchers also noted significant variability between States as well as gaps in treatment.
